which element is always present in proteins but not in carbohydrates or lipids? sulfur nitrogen phosphorus calcium
Answer
Brief Explanations:
Carbohydrates and lipids are composed mainly of carbon, hydrogen, and oxygen. Proteins are made up of amino - acids, and nitrogen is a key component of amino - acids. Sulfur can be present in some proteins but not always, phosphorus is not a main component of basic protein structure, and calcium is not a component of proteins.
Answer:
Nitrogen
